This demonstration shows working code to automate the adding of items on a drop down list when they are not found on the list. The code demonstrates how to detect when the item the user is trying to enter is not on the list. The code then gets the user's permission to add the item and take the user to a form where the item is entered for the person. When the user closes the form, the user is taken back to the combo box (drop down list) which has been refreshed and the newly added item has been selected.
